Formulation of stochastic contact Hamiltonian systems
1School of Mathematics and Statistics and Center for Mathematical Sciences, Huazhong University of Science and Technology, Wuhan 430074, China.
Abstract:
In this work, we devise a stochastic version of contact Hamiltonian systems and show that the phase flows of these systems preserve contact structures. Moreover, we provide a sufficient condition under which these stochastic contact Hamiltonian systems are completely integrable. This establishes an appropriate framework for investigating stochastic contact Hamiltonian systems.
